High CVSS 7.5
CVE-2026-14809
Prog Management System developed by PROG MIS has a SQL Injection vulnerability, allowing unauthenticated remote attackers to inject arbitrary SQL commands to read database contents.
What this means
- Exposure
- Exploitable remotely over the network, without authentication and with no action from the victim.
- Impact
- An attacker can read sensitive data.
- Weakness
- Unescaped input is placed into an SQL query, letting the attacker read or alter the database (SQL injection).
- Likelihood
- Its EPSS score stays low: nothing points to imminent exploitation, which is no reason to leave it unpatched.
What to doFold into the next patch cycle. Start with the instances exposed to the internet.
